From global to local
English to Spanish localisation
As you may know, there isn’t really one single universal Spanish language. Many words and phrases can be singular to a particular area and would be as foreign to a Spanish-speaker from outside the region as words from Mandarin or Elvish. On the other hand, there are some words that can be used in all regions but which have totally different meanings depending on which region you’re in.
Localisation goes beyond the mere translation of content. It’s about understanding the culture behind the specific language to make it look and sound more native to your target audience. So, if you’re planning on expanding your business to the Spanish market, it’s important to employ the right language. You want the language to sound as natural as possible to the locals, but you also want to avoid mistakenly offending anyone. Therefore, only qualified and experienced English-Spanish translators can deliver the right and appropriate content when translating from English to Spanish.
GOING GLOBAL
Spanish, a world language
The Spanish language is the second most widely spoken language in the world both in terms of number of speakers and in terms of number of countries in which Spanish is the primary language. Today, there are more than 400 million Spanish-Speakers worldwide and Spanish appears as the official language in 21 countries spread across America, Spain in Europe and Equitorial Guinea in Africa.
Although the Spanish language was born in Spain, the country with the most Spanish-Speakers is nowadays Mexico, with approximately 110 million. It is also a language used by numerous known artists and writers around the world like Cervantes, Picasso and García Márquez. Thus it is a vehicle of international communication but it also explains why it is such an important language in international politics, economics and culture.
SIMILARITIES & DIFFERENCES
English-Spanish language history
The English and Spanish languages have very different origins. English is a West Germanic language and is the most spoken language of the Germanic languages while Spanish derives from latin and is the most spoken Romance language both in terms of number of speakers and the number of countries in which it is the primary language. So it really is a clash of two of the great world languages.
Despite the massive differences, the two languages have managed to influence one another over the years. This is not only down to the fact that tapas has found its audience in the English speaking countries or that email is the preferred form of mail correspondence in Spain. Many words in the English language, that is considered to be of English origin, actually derive from Spanish. You probably didn’t know that hurricane comes from the Spanish huracán, did you? LANGUAGE COMBINATIONS
Links between the English and Spanish markets
English is a commonly spoken language in Spanish speaking countries. It is estimated that around 27% or just over a quarter of the population can speak English. In Latin America, there are over 5 million English speakers, making English the third most spoken language in South America.
Likewise, Spanish is widely spoken in English speaking countries. 8% of the UK population can speak Spanish. And in the US, as much as 13.5% of the population speaks Spanish at home, a number that continues to grow. In fact, the US is the second largest Spanish speaking country in the world after Mexico.
The two languages are linked, both having a strong presence in the English and Spanish markets. It is important to consider this when looking into translations for your content.
